Natural nutrition begins here. Instinct Be Natural Real Lamb & Oatmeal Recipe starts with grass-fed lamb and never contains filler, corn, wheat, soy or by-product meals or artificial preservatives and colors. Guided by our belief in the power of raw, each piece is tumbled with crushed freeze-dried raw lamb - raising the bar in nutrition and taste.

  • - Grass-fed lamb is our first ingredient, making real animal proteins our #1 and #2 ingredients followed by hearty whole grains
  • - No fillers - made without corn, wheat, soy, chicken or poultry by-product meal, brewer's rice, artificial colors or preservatives
  • - Raw on every piece - our kibble is tumbled with freeze-dried raw for nutrition and taste
  • - We believe in the power of raw because raw is real meat, natural, protein packed, minimally processed and made from whole-food ingredients
  • - Made in the USA with the finest ingredients from around the world. Natural nutrition with added vitamins and minerals

Guaranteed Analysis

Crude Protein (min): 26.0%, Crude Fat (min): 15.5%, Crude Fiber (max): 5.0%, Moisture (max): 10.0%, Vitamin E (min): 100 IU/kg, *Omega 3 Fatty Acids (min): 0.5%, *Omega 6 Fatty Acids (min): 2.4%, *Not recognized as an essential nutrient by the AAFCO Dog Food Nutrient Profiles.

Ideal feeding amounts will vary by age, weight, and activity level so the guide below should be used as an initial recommendation. Divide the cups per day by the number of feedings per day. Daily Feeding Guidelines (standard 8 oz dry measuring cup): Adult Maintenance (cups per day): 5-15 lb: 1/2 - 1 1/4 cups; 16-25 lb: 1 1/4 - 1 3/4 cups; 26-50 lb: 1 3/4 - 3 cups; 51-75 lb: 3 - 4 cups; 76-100 lb: 4 - 5 1/2 cups Weight Loss (cups per day): 5-15 lb: 1/4 - 3/4 cup; 16-25 lb: 3/4 - 1 cup; 26-50 lb: 1 - 1 3/4 cups; 51-75 lb: 1 3/4 - 2 1/2 cups; 76-100 lb: 2 1/2 - 3 1/2 cups Puppies (Except Large Breed (70+lbs as an adult)): Feed up to twice the adult maintenance amount. Pregnant/Nursing Females: Feed up to three times the adult maintenance amount shown above. Dogs greater than 100 lbs: add up to 3/4 cup for every 20 lbs. Transitioning to Instinct: Always introduce a new food over a period of 5 to 7 days, mixing increasing amounts of Instinct with the current food each day.

Thank you for leaving a review! Our canola oil is sourced from the United States and is obtained from hybridized rapeseed. These special rapeseed plants have been bred to be free of toxic gossypol. The end result was the canola plant, a version of the rapeseed plant but very low in erucic acid. So, through traditional breeding techniques, it has been modified from its original form. Canola Oil is low-allergen oil, also considered to be beneficial due to its low saturated fat and high monounsaturated oil content โ€“ the latter almost 60%. It also has a favorable omega-3 fatty acid profile. Canola oil is safe for animals and was required to go through stringent animal feeding trials to ensure it was a safe, edible oil.
